Advanced Certificate in International Law & Indigenous Rights: UK Career Outlook

Career Role Description
International Human Rights Lawyer (Indigenous Rights Focus) Advocate for Indigenous communities facing legal challenges, specializing in international human rights law. High demand for expertise in self-determination and land rights.
International Development Specialist (Indigenous Affairs) Design and implement development projects that prioritize Indigenous participation and benefit-sharing, requiring strong understanding of international law and cultural sensitivity.
Legal Researcher (International Indigenous Law) Conduct in-depth legal research on Indigenous rights, supporting academics, NGOs, and international organizations working on relevant policy and advocacy.
Policy Advisor (Indigenous Rights & International Law) Provide expert advice to governments and international bodies on policy development related to Indigenous rights within a framework of international law. Requires strong analytical and communication skills.
